Emergency Board Up Service in Kansas City, KS

Emergency board-up services provide immediate protection for properties that have experienced damage or intrusion, such as after storms, vandalism, or accidents. This service involves securing broken windows, doors, and other openings with sturdy materials to prevent further damage, theft, or unwanted entry. Projects typically include boarding up windows and doors, covering roof openings, and sealing off compromised areas until permanent repairs can be made. Property owners should understand the scope of the damage, the urgency of the situation, and any access restrictions before requesting board-up assistance.

Before requesting emergency board-up services, property owners often want to know what materials will be used, how long the securing process might take, and whether the service includes temporary protection for the interior. It’s also helpful to understand if the service covers both residential and commercial properties and what steps are involved in maintaining the security until permanent repairs can be scheduled. Clear communication about the extent of the damage and any special considerations can help ensure the service effectively safeguards the property during the interim period.

FAQ

Emergency Board Up Service Questions

What is emergency board up service? It involves securing a property quickly after damage to prevent further harm or intrusion.

When should property owners consider a board up? When windows or doors are broken or compromised, especially after storms or accidents.

What materials are used for board up services? Typically, plywood or similar sturdy materials are used to cover damaged openings.

Does the service include securing all types of property damage? Yes, it covers various situations like broken windows, door damage, or roof openings.
